
The Turkey Leg Bar (1125-1135 SE Grand Ave)
• American • Sandwich • Salads • $ • Info
x Available Sunday 5:00 AM
1125-1135 Se Grand Ave, Portland, OR 97214
x $0 delivery fee
Other fees x
Enter address
to see delivery time
Sunday
5:00 AM - 6:00 AM
Monday - Saturday